#menu_btn{background:#f05082}#menu_content{background:#fde5ec}#menu_content #gnavi{position:relative}#menu_content #gnavi ul{padding-bottom:2.5em}#menu_content #gnavi li{margin:0.8% 0}#menu_content #gnavi li .img{width:11vmin}#menu_content #gnavi .copyrights{width:80vw;position:absolute;bottom:0;right:0;text-align:right;margin-bottom:0.8%;z-index:-1}#menu_content #gnavi .copyrights.rightbox{bottom:0}@media screen and (orientation: portrait){#menu_content #gnavi li .img{width:8vmax}#menu_content #gnavi li .txt{font-size:12px;line-height:1.2em}}.bottom-contents{width:60%}.bottom-contents ul li{width:22%;margin-right:4%}.bottom-contents ul li:nth-child(5n){margin-right:4%}.bottom-contents ul li:nth-child(4n){margin-right:0}@media only screen and (max-width: 960px){.bottom-contents{width:80%}}body{background:#ffffff}#arrows{display:none}#scroll_arrow{width:80px;text-align:center;position:absolute;bottom:64px;right:20px;margin-left:-40px;cursor:pointer;opacity:1}.is-frame-fixed #scroll_arrow{opacity:0;-moz-transition:ease-in,.3s;-o-transition:ease-in,.3s;-webkit-transition:ease-in,.3s;transition:ease-in,.3s}#scroll_arrow .next{display:inline-block;width:30px;height:30px;border-right:1px solid #000000;border-bottom:1px solid #000000;-moz-animation:down 2s infinite;-webkit-animation:down 2s infinite;animation:down 2s infinite}#scroll_arrow .scroll{font-family:"Hiragino Kaku Gothic W3 JIS2004", Sans-Serif;font-size:16px;color:#000000}@-webkit-keyframes down{0%{-moz-transform:translate(0, -20px) rotate(45deg);-ms-transform:translate(0, -20px) rotate(45deg);-webkit-transform:translate(0, -20px) rotate(45deg);transform:translate(0, -20px) rotate(45deg);opacity:0}15%{opacity:1}55%{opacity:1}70%{-moz-transform:translate(0, 0) rotate(45deg);-ms-transform:translate(0, 0) rotate(45deg);-webkit-transform:translate(0, 0) rotate(45deg);transform:translate(0, 0) rotate(45deg);opacity:0}100%{opacity:0}}@keyframes down{0%{-moz-transform:translate(0, -20px) rotate(45deg);-ms-transform:translate(0, -20px) rotate(45deg);-webkit-transform:translate(0, -20px) rotate(45deg);transform:translate(0, -20px) rotate(45deg);opacity:0}15%{opacity:1}55%{opacity:1}70%{-moz-transform:translate(0, 0) rotate(45deg);-ms-transform:translate(0, 0) rotate(45deg);-webkit-transform:translate(0, 0) rotate(45deg);transform:translate(0, 0) rotate(45deg);opacity:0}100%{opacity:0}}.main{margin-top:-44px}.shoulder{width:300px;position:absolute;top:44px;left:0}.hotspring-first{position:relative;height:calc(100vh - (44px * 2))}.hotspring-first::before{content:"";width:100%;height:100%;background:url("/book/monthly/202104/images/hotspring/main01.jpg") no-repeat center bottom/cover;position:fixed;top:0;left:0;z-index:-1}.hotspring-first::after{content:"";width:100%;height:100%;background:rgba(255,255,255,0.7);position:absolute;top:0;left:0;z-index:0}.hotspring-first .inner{width:100%;height:100%;display:-webkit-flex;display:flex;-webkit-flex-direction:row-reverse;flex-direction:row-reverse;-webkit-justify-content:center;justify-content:center;-webkit-align-items:center;align-items:center;position:relative;z-index:1}.hotspring-first .main-ttl{width:16.6%;max-width:212px;margin:0 auto;margin:0}@media only screen and (max-width: 960px){.hotspring-first .main-ttl{width:26.6%}}.hotspring-first .main-lead{width:29.3%;max-width:375px;margin:0 auto;margin:0}@media only screen and (max-width: 960px){.hotspring-first .main-lead{width:39.3%}}.hotspring-second{position:relative;width:100vw;height:100vh}.hotspring-second .photo-caption{width:26em;position:absolute;bottom:60px;left:60px;font-family:"Hiragino Kaku Gothic W3 JIS2004", Sans-Serif;font-size:17px;line-height:1.4;color:#ffffff;text-shadow:0 0 4px rgba(0,0,0,0.4)}@media only screen and (max-width: 1280px){.hotspring-second .photo-caption{font-size:15px;font-size:1.46484vw}}@media only screen and (max-width: 960px){.hotspring-second .photo-caption{font-size:2vw}}.hotspring-second.is-fixed::before,.hotspring-second.is-fixed .shoulder{position:fixed;left:44px}.hotspring-third{position:relative;width:100vw;height:100vh;background:#ffffff}.hotspring-third .bg{width:100%;height:100%;background:url("/book/monthly/202104/images/hotspring/main02.jpg") no-repeat center bottom/cover;position:absolute;top:0;left:0}.hotspring-third .photo-caption{width:26em;position:absolute;bottom:60px;right:20px;font-family:"Hiragino Kaku Gothic W3 JIS2004", Sans-Serif;font-size:17px;color:#ffffff;text-shadow:0 0 4px rgba(0,0,0,0.4)}@media only screen and (max-width: 1280px){.hotspring-third .photo-caption{font-size:15px;font-size:1.46484vw}}@media only screen and (max-width: 960px){.hotspring-third .photo-caption{font-size:2vw}}.hotspring-third.is-fixed .bg,.hotspring-third.is-fixed .shoulder{position:fixed;left:44px}.hotspring-fourth{position:relative;width:100vw;height:100vh;background:#ffffff}.hotspring-fourth .bg{width:100%;height:100%;background:url("/book/monthly/202104/images/hotspring/main03.jpg") no-repeat center top/cover;position:absolute;top:0;left:0}.hotspring-fourth .photo-caption{width:28em;position:absolute;bottom:60px;right:20px;font-family:"Hiragino Kaku Gothic W3 JIS2004", Sans-Serif;font-size:17px;color:#ffffff;text-shadow:0 0 4px rgba(0,0,0,0.8)}@media only screen and (max-width: 1280px){.hotspring-fourth .photo-caption{font-size:15px;font-size:1.46484vw}}@media only screen and (max-width: 960px){.hotspring-fourth .photo-caption{font-size:2vw}}.hotspring-fourth.is-fixed .bg,.hotspring-fourth.is-fixed .shoulder{position:fixed;left:44px}.hotspring-article{background:#ffffff;position:relative}.hotspring-article .summary-block{background:url("/book/monthly/202104/images/hotspring/summary_bg.jpg") no-repeat center bottom/1192px auto;padding:90px 0 60px}.hotspring-article .summary-ttl{font-family:"Hiragino Mincho W3 JIS2004", serif;font-size:30px;line-height:1.75;text-align:center;padding-bottom:50px}@media only screen and (max-width: 1280px){.hotspring-article .summary-ttl{font-size:28px;font-size:2.73438vw}}@media only screen and (max-width: 960px){.hotspring-article .summary-ttl{font-size:3.73333vw}}.hotspring-article .summary-txt{width:70%;max-width:896px;margin:0 auto}@media only screen and (max-width: 960px){.hotspring-article .summary-txt{width:80%}}.hotspring-article .summary-txt p{width:60%;font-size:17px;line-height:1.8;color:#3c3c3c}@media only screen and (max-width: 1280px){.hotspring-article .summary-txt p{font-size:15px;font-size:1.46484vw}}@media only screen and (max-width: 960px){.hotspring-article .summary-txt p{font-size:2vw}}.hotspring-article .summary-txt p+p{margin-top:1.5em}.hotspring-article .summary-txt .staff-credit{font-size:13px}@media only screen and (max-width: 1280px){.hotspring-article .summary-txt .staff-credit{font-size:11px;font-size:1.07422vw}}@media only screen and (max-width: 960px){.hotspring-article .summary-txt .staff-credit{font-size:1.46667vw}}@media only screen and (max-width: 1280px){.hotspring-article .summary-block{background-size:100% auto}}.hotspring-article .data-block{width:90%;max-width:1152px;margin:0 auto}@media only screen and (max-width: 960px){.hotspring-article .data-block{width:100%}}.hotspring-article .data-ttl{width:34%;margin:0 auto}.hotspring-article .data-wrap{position:relative;padding:15px 0;display:-webkit-flex;display:flex;-webkit-justify-content:center;justify-content:center;-webkit-align-items:center;align-items:center}.hotspring-article .data-wrap::before{content:"";width:100vw;height:100%;background:#e9f3f1;position:absolute;top:0;left:50%;margin-left:-50vw}.hotspring-article .data-wrap dl{position:relative;background:#FFFFFF;padding:25px 40px;font-family:"Hiragino Mincho W6 JIS2004", serif;font-size:22px;line-height:1.6}@media only screen and (max-width: 1280px){.hotspring-article .data-wrap dl{font-size:20px;font-size:1.95313vw}}@media only screen and (max-width: 960px){.hotspring-article .data-wrap dl{font-size:2.66667vw}}.hotspring-article .data-wrap dl dt{color:#6cafa0;float:left;clear:left}.hotspring-article .data-wrap dl dd{padding-left:3em}.hotspring-article .areainfo-block{width:90%;max-width:1152px;margin:0 auto;padding-top:80px}@media only screen and (max-width: 960px){.hotspring-article .areainfo-block{width:100%}}.hotspring-article .areainfo-ttl{width:34%;margin:0 auto}.hotspring-article .areainfo-imgbox{padding:30px 0}.hotspring-article .areainfo-imgbox .txt{font-size:14px;line-height:1.7;color:#3c3c3c}@media only screen and (max-width: 1280px){.hotspring-article .areainfo-imgbox .txt{font-size:12px;font-size:1.17188vw}}@media only screen and (max-width: 960px){.hotspring-article .areainfo-imgbox .txt{font-size:1.6vw}}.hotspring-article .areainfo-imgbox .name{font-family:"Hiragino Mincho W6 JIS2004", serif;font-size:19px;display:block;text-align:center}@media only screen and (max-width: 1280px){.hotspring-article .areainfo-imgbox .name{font-size:17px;font-size:1.66016vw}}@media only screen and (max-width: 960px){.hotspring-article .areainfo-imgbox .name{font-size:2.26667vw}}.hotspring-article .areainfo-imgbox.imgbox01{width:63%;margin:0 auto;display:-webkit-flex;display:flex;-webkit-justify-content:space-between;justify-content:space-between;-webkit-align-items:center;align-items:center}.hotspring-article .areainfo-imgbox.imgbox01 .img01{width:57.5%}.hotspring-article .areainfo-imgbox.imgbox01 .txt{width:36.6%}.hotspring-article .areainfo-imgbox.imgbox02{width:63%;margin:0 auto;display:-webkit-flex;display:flex;-webkit-flex-wrap:wrap;flex-wrap:wrap;-webkit-justify-content:space-between;justify-content:space-between;-webkit-align-items:center;align-items:center}.hotspring-article .areainfo-imgbox.imgbox02 .img02{width:92.7%;margin-left:auto;margin-bottom:20px}.hotspring-article .areainfo-imgbox.imgbox02 .img03{width:36.2%}.hotspring-article .areainfo-imgbox.imgbox02 .txt{width:51.3%;margin-right:7%}.hotspring-article .areainfo-imgbox.imgbox03{width:70%;margin:0 auto;display:-webkit-flex;display:flex;-webkit-flex-wrap:wrap;flex-wrap:wrap;-webkit-justify-content:space-between;justify-content:space-between;-webkit-align-items:flex-end;align-items:flex-end}.hotspring-article .areainfo-imgbox.imgbox03 .img04{width:50.8%}.hotspring-article .areainfo-imgbox.imgbox03 .img05{width:45.8%}.hotspring-article .areainfo-imgbox.imgbox03 .txt{width:80%;margin:20px auto 0}.hotspring-article .areainfo-imgbox.imgbox04{width:60%;margin:0 auto;display:-webkit-flex;display:flex;-webkit-justify-content:space-between;justify-content:space-between;-webkit-align-items:center;align-items:center}.hotspring-article .areainfo-imgbox.imgbox04 .img06{width:64.4%}.hotspring-article .areainfo-imgbox.imgbox04 .txt{width:29.3%}.hotspring-article .hotel-block{width:90%;max-width:1152px;margin:0 auto;padding-top:80px;padding-bottom:50px}@media only screen and (max-width: 960px){.hotspring-article .hotel-block{width:100%}}.hotspring-article .hotel-ttl{width:34%;margin:0 auto 10px}.hotspring-article .hotel-box{background:#f3f9f7;border-top:2px solid #6cafa0;padding:30px 5%;margin-bottom:30px;box-sizing:border-box;overflow:hidden}.hotspring-article .hotel-box:last-child{margin-bottom:0}.hotspring-article .hotel-box .subttl{font-family:"Hiragino Mincho W3 JIS2004", serif;font-size:20px;line-height:1.3;color:#6cafa0;padding-left:20px}@media only screen and (max-width: 1280px){.hotspring-article .hotel-box .subttl{font-size:18px;font-size:1.75781vw}}@media only screen and (max-width: 960px){.hotspring-article .hotel-box .subttl{font-size:2.4vw}}.hotspring-article .hotel-box .name{font-family:"Hiragino Mincho W6 JIS2004", serif;font-size:28px;line-height:1.3;margin-bottom:10px;padding-left:20px}@media only screen and (max-width: 1280px){.hotspring-article .hotel-box .name{font-size:26px;font-size:2.53906vw}}@media only screen and (max-width: 960px){.hotspring-article .hotel-box .name{font-size:3.46667vw}}.hotspring-article .hotel-box .img{width:47.3%;float:left}.hotspring-article .hotel-box .img .note{display:block;font-size:13px;color:#3c3c3c}@media only screen and (max-width: 1280px){.hotspring-article .hotel-box .img .note{font-size:11px;font-size:1.07422vw}}@media only screen and (max-width: 960px){.hotspring-article .hotel-box .img .note{font-size:1.46667vw}}.hotspring-article .hotel-box .txt{width:49.6%;float:right}.hotspring-article .hotel-box .txt p{font-size:16px;line-height:1.4;color:#3c3c3c}@media only screen and (max-width: 1280px){.hotspring-article .hotel-box .txt p{font-size:14px;font-size:1.36719vw}}@media only screen and (max-width: 960px){.hotspring-article .hotel-box .txt p{font-size:1.86667vw}}.hotspring-article .hotel-box .txt .info{font-size:14px;line-height:1.5;margin-top:1.5em}@media only screen and (max-width: 1280px){.hotspring-article .hotel-box .txt .info{font-size:12px;font-size:1.17188vw}}@media only screen and (max-width: 960px){.hotspring-article .hotel-box .txt .info{font-size:1.6vw}}.hotspring-article .hotel-box .txt a{color:inherit;text-decoration:underline}.hotspring-article .hotel-box .txt a:hover{text-decoration:none}#footer{background:#ffffff}.is-anm{opacity:0;transition:opacity .8s ease-in-out,all .8s ease}.is-anm.is-done{opacity:1;transform:translate(0, 0)}.fade-up{transform:translate(0, 30px)}.fade-down{transform:translate(0, -30px)}.fade-left{transform:translate(-20px, 0)}.fade-right{transform:translate(20px, 0)}.fade-scale{transform:scale(0.5);transition:all .8s cubic-bezier(0.65, -0.55, 0.265, 1.55)}.fade-scale.is-done{transform:scale(1)}.hotspring-first .main-ttl,.hotspring-first .main-lead{opacity:0;transform:translate(0, -30px);transition:opacity .8s ease-in-out,all .8s ease}.hotspring-first.is-loaded .main-ttl{opacity:1;transform:translate(0, 0)}.hotspring-first.is-loaded .main-lead{opacity:1;transform:translate(0, 0);transition-delay:.3s}
